Transaction 16637d817ccf1334405e07df2ff9d177dd7cd561cc32a7d38cd0d147863ae11a
1 Input
1 Output
-
16637d817ccf1334405e07df2ff9d177dd7cd561cc32a7d38cd0d147863ae11a:0
- value
- 89405
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 145d236b609f020c4981e86f4b960e3d29eee06e5a3f75b340d8d1d757c34cdb
- address
- bc1pz3wjx6mqnupqcjvpaph5h9sw8557acrwtglhtv6qmrgaw47rfnds9sgshj